Financial Accountant Visa Sponsorship Jobs in New Mexico

Financial accountant visa sponsorship jobs in New Mexico are concentrated in Albuquerque and Santa Fe, where state agencies, federal contractors like Sandia National Laboratories, and healthcare systems such as Presbyterian Healthcare Services maintain active finance teams. The oil and gas sector in the Permian Basin region also generates demand for qualified financial accountants seeking H-1B sponsorship.

Financial Accountant Jobs in New Mexico: Frequently Asked Questions

Which companies sponsor visas for financial accountants in New Mexico?

Federal contractors and research institutions lead sponsorship activity in New Mexico. Sandia National Laboratories and Los Alamos National Laboratory have both filed H-1B applications for finance and accounting roles. Large healthcare systems, including Presbyterian Healthcare Services and University of New Mexico Hospital, also sponsor financial accountants. State government agencies and public universities round out the employer pool, particularly for budget and audit-related positions.

Which visa types are most common for financial accountant roles in New Mexico?

The H-1B is the most common visa category for financial accountants in New Mexico, as the role typically meets the specialty occupation requirement through its bachelor's degree prerequisite in accounting, finance, or a related field. Candidates from Australia may qualify for the E-3 visa. Those with Canadian or Mexican citizenship may be eligible under TN status, which includes accountants as a specifically listed occupation under USMCA.

Which cities in New Mexico have the most financial accountant sponsorship jobs?

Albuquerque accounts for the largest share of financial accountant sponsorship opportunities in New Mexico, driven by its concentration of federal contractors, healthcare employers, and corporate headquarters. Santa Fe follows, with demand from state government agencies and nonprofits. Hobbs and Carlsbad see periodic openings tied to oil and gas operators in the Permian Basin, where accounting functions support extraction and energy finance teams.

Are there state-specific factors that affect financial accountant visa sponsorship in New Mexico?

New Mexico's economy is heavily influenced by federal spending, energy, and healthcare, which shapes which employers have the legal infrastructure to sponsor visas. Federal contractors like national laboratories operate under strict compliance frameworks and tend to be experienced sponsors. The state also has a strong pipeline of accounting graduates from the University of New Mexico and New Mexico State University, which means employers are familiar with international talent though competition for sponsored roles can still be meaningful.

What is the prevailing wage for sponsored financial accountant jobs in New Mexico?

U.S. employers sponsoring a visa must pay at least the prevailing wage, which is what workers in the same role, area, and experience level typically earn. The Department of Labor sets this rate to make sure companies aren't hiring foreign workers simply because they'd accept lower pay than a U.S. worker. It varies by job title, location, and experience. You can look up current prevailing wage rates for any occupation and location using the OFLC Wage Search page.
